What Is Bead Graph Paper?
Bead graph paper is a type of grid paper specifically designed for planning beadwork patterns. Its grid is typically composed of small squares or diamonds, representing individual beads, which helps artists visualize how beads will fit together in their final design. This paper allows for detailed planning, ensuring that the finished piece is both beautiful and structurally sound.
Features of Bead Graph Paper
- Grid Size: Usually 5mm or smaller, matching common bead sizes like seed beads.
- Grid Shape: Often square or diamond-shaped, facilitating different beading techniques such as peyote, brick stitch, or loom work.
- Design Flexibility: Provides space for color coding, pattern marking, and annotations.

How to Use Bead Graph Paper Effectively
Once you've obtained your free bead graph paper, the next step is to use it effectively to design stunning beadwork.
Step-by-Step Guide to Using Bead Graph Paper
- Determine Your Bead Size: Know the diameter of your beads to select the appropriate grid size.
- Sketch Your Pattern: Use colored pencils or digital tools to visualize your design on the grid.
- Plan Color Placement: Mark different colors or bead types with distinct symbols or colors on your pattern.
- Create a Legend: Maintain a key that explains what each symbol or color represents for clarity during stitching.
- Start Beading: Follow your pattern, referring to the graph paper as a guide to ensure accuracy.
Tips for Maximizing Your Pattern Design
- Use Digital Tools: Software like Excel, Google Sheets, or specialized pattern design apps can help create and modify designs digitally before printing.
- Color Code: Clearly distinguish colors and bead types to prevent mistakes during assembly.
- Keep Consistent: Use the same grid size and symbols throughout your project for uniformity.
- Test Your Design: Make small samples to see how your pattern looks in real beads before committing to large pieces.
